The Dollar Parlor and Denny Daniel’s Museum of Interesting Things.

Steve Rogers visits The Dollar Parlor in Beach Haven, NJ, a fun version of the classic five-and-dime, on the occasion of the store’s 50th anniversary. The landmark is known for its quirky personality and merchandise, retro toys and pranks. He also tours Denny Daniel’s Museum of Interesting Things, a collection that includes historical artifacts, forgotten inventions and playthings from the past.
